Irish Emergency Alliance Company Limited By Guarantee (IEA) is recruiting a Fundraising and Project Coordinator based on Dublin. The basic weekly hour is 37.5 hours. Minimum salary is €35,000. As the IEA Fundraising and Project Manager, your primary role will be focused on supporting the IEA Secretariat to generate more money for members' emergency operations in response to major international crises. You will assist the Executive Director with planning and organising tasks both during and outside of Active Appeal Periods (AAPs). This will require a diverse range of skills to include time management, computer proficiency, website content knowledge, fundraising planning, attention to detail, excellent communication, organisational skills, adaptability, multi-tasking, analysing data, and confidentiality. Applicants are expected to meet all essential criteria and are strongly encouraged to demonstrate the desirable skills and experience outlined in the job description. Working Group (WG) Coordination • Coordinate activities across all IEA Working Groups (Fundraising, Programmes, Communications, Website, Fulfilment), including scheduling, agenda preparation, minute-taking, task tracking, and follow-up. • Support the planning and implementation of joint appeals, working closely with WG Leads to manage timelines, deliverables, and campaign materials. • Liaise across WGs to ensure alignment and timely delivery of campaign and programme outputs. • Draft and update campaign briefs and ensure coordination of WG inputs into appeal planning, implementation, and review. • Assesses departmental operations and stakeholder interactions to identify bottlenecks affecting fundraising or project delivery. • Reviews and refines internal systems and procedures to improve efficiency in fundraising, donor engagement, and reporting processes. • Analyses work methods and resource use within fundraising and project teams, recommending improvements to maximise impact and reduce inefficiencies. • Plans and sequences project and fundraising activities, defining timelines, milestones, and dependencies to ensure timely and cost-effective execution. Board and Committee Support • Schedule and organise Board meetings and Sub-Committee meetings (e.g. Audit & Risk, Governance). • Prepare and distribute meeting packs, agendas, and minutes in a timely and professional manner. • Track follow-up actions and ensure timely completion of agreed items. • Support Board engagement with Working Groups and ensure information is accurately and efficiently shared between governance and operational structures. Appeal Coordination and Programme Support • Assist with post-appeal analysis and reporting, working with Member Agencies to collate expenditure and income data. • Coordinate monthly programme updates and ensure reports, case studies, and impact stories are gathered for internal and external use. • Maintain oversight of IEA's compliance with GDPR and other relevant policies and procedures.
